Smarter Than Ever Before – Tech That Talks
The Activa E is a leap in connected mobility. The smart LCD display shows battery percentage, estimated range, speed, and even ride statistics. With Bluetooth connectivity, it can alert you for incoming calls, messages, and even turn-by-turn navigation.
Through the My Honda+ app, you can track your scooter, set geo-fences, and receive service alerts. Anti-theft alerts and remote immobilization make it safer than ever.
It also features multiple ride modes—Eco for long range, Normal for balanced use, and Power for quick sprints. A dedicated Reverse Mode helps you easily pull it out of tight parking spots—something you’ll appreciate more than you think.
Miles and Smiles – The Real-World Efficiency
Now let’s talk about what really matters: how far can it go on one charge? Honda claims a range of 120 km under ideal conditions, and early testers are reporting 100–110 km in real-world city riding. That’s more than enough for most users who typically travel 20–30 km daily.
Charging the Activa E from 0 to 100% takes about 5 hours with a standard home charger, while the fast charger can juice it up to 80% in 2 hours. It also supports portable battery packs, which can be detached and charged inside your home—just like your smartphone.
Compared to petrol scooters, this could mean savings of ₹2,000 to ₹3,000 per month just on fuel!
Value That Fits Different Budgets
Honda is offering the Activa E in two main variants—a Standard model for budget-conscious buyers and a Pro model with extra features like fast charging, enhanced connectivity, and alloy wheels.
Expected pricing is around ₹1.05 lakh for the base variant and up to ₹1.25 lakh for the Pro variant (ex-showroom). When you consider the long-term savings on fuel and maintenance, the price starts to make a lot of sense.
Government subsidies like FAME-II and state-level EV benefits could also reduce the on-road price significantly in some states.
